#47A9CD Color
#47A9CD is rgb(71, 169, 205) in RGB, hsl(196, 57%, 54%) in HSL, and about cmyk(65%, 18%, 0%, 20%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Maximum Blue (#47ABCC),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 1.93.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#47A9CD Channel Values
How #47A9CD bre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 71 · G 169 · B 205 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 196° · S 57% · L 54%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 196° · S 65% · V 80%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 65% · M 18% · Y 0% · K 20%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.68:1 vs white · 7.82: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#47A9CD background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#47A9CD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#47A9CD?
#47A9CD is a mid-tone teal — rgb(71, 169, 205) in RGB and hsl(196, 57%, 54%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Maximum Blue (#47ABCC),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 1.93.
What is the RGB value of #47A9CD?
#47A9CD is rgb(71, 169, 205) — red 71, green 169, and blue 205 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#47A9CD?
#47A9CD converts to approximately cmyk(65%, 18%, 0%, 20%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#47A9CD be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#47A9CD scores 2.68:1 against white and 7.82: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#47A9CD as a CSS color keyword?
No. #47A9CD is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is skyblue (#87CEEB) at a CIE76 distance of 15.78, which is visibly different.
